Six months ago I bought an Kyocera telephone at the Verizon office in Oceanside, CA. I was told it was a reliable phone but I still bought replacemnent insurance on it. A month later the screen went blank and it only worked sporadically. I asked Verizon for support and they had Kyocera send me a "refurbished" replacement. The phone worked OK for about a month and I experienced the same problem. Verizon again had Kyocera send me another "refurbished" replacement. About a month later the same problem happened and they offered to have it replaced agai. I refused and purchased an LG telephone that has been working fine. Verizon said I still had to pay for the Kyocera phone or get another "Refurbished" phone because the replacement insurance only covered replacement. Your Kyocera phone is not good and I would like to have my money back instead of having to still make monthly payments for a phone that does not work. If you stand behind your product what is my alternative.
